A Fallout 4 VR F4SE plugin that adds full-body IK, weapon repositioning, an in-VR Pip-Boy, and hand-pose / finger control.
FRIK gives Fallout 4 VR players a visible full body with inverse kinematics and VR-focused interaction systems. It runs as an F4SE plugin DLL (FRIK.dll) and uses F4VR Common Framework for plugin lifecycle, VR controller input, config hot-reload, VR UI widgets, and shared game utilities.
Fallout 4 VR renders the player as disembodied hands. FRIK adds a configurable full-body avatar, body and camera alignment tools, two-handed weapon handling, physical Pip-Boy interaction, and in-game configuration UI.
What it provides:
- Full-body IK - body posture, arm solving, leg walking, head/neck posture, and hand poses.
- Weapon positioning - per-weapon offsets, offhand grip, throwable adjustment, and back-of-hand UI placement.
- Pip-Boy interaction - wrist and holo Pip-Boy positioning, finger interaction, flashlight controls, and related hand poses.
- In-game configuration - VR UI panels for body, Pip-Boy, and weapon adjustment.
- Mod integration - public FRIK API, Papyrus functions, BetterScopesVR support, Fallout London VR handling, and Immersive Flashlight VR compatibility.
Download from Nexus Mods and install the published mod package through your mod manager, then enable the FRIK.esp plugin. Load order does not matter.
Manual setup, including the required Fallout4Custom.ini edits, is covered in the installation guide. Skipping those edits is a common cause of crashes on new games and save loads.
- BetterScopesVR - supported; FRIK repositions scope reticles and adjusts dampening while looking through a scope.
- Fallout London VR - detected automatically; swaps the Pip-Boy for the Attaboy and loads
FRIK_FOLVR.inioverrides. - Immersive Flashlight VR - compatible; FRIK disables its embedded flashlight to avoid conflicts.
- Mods that modify the player skeleton (body, heel, or pose mods) can conflict and cause crashes - run only what you need.
Once installed, FRIK shows your full body in VR automatically. Open the in-game configuration to fine-tune the body and camera (hold both thumbsticks for ~1.5 seconds), reposition weapons, and adjust the Pip-Boy. Most settings apply live, and advanced options live in FRIK.ini.

git clone https://github.com/rollingrock/Fallout-4-VR-Body.git
cd Fallout-4-VR-Body
git submodule update --init --recursive
cmake --preset default
cmake --build build --config ReleaseThis generates the Visual Studio solution in build/. Open build/FRIK.slnx if you prefer building or debugging in Visual Studio. Project configuration belongs in CMakeLists.txt, not the generated VS project files. Release builds automatically produce a .7z package in build/package.
For local post-build copying, copy CMakeUserPresets.json.template to CMakeUserPresets.json and set COPY_PLUGIN_BASE_PATH to your MO2 mod folder or Fallout 4 VR Data folder. More development notes are in docs/development.md.
